What is an Edwardian Conservatory?
Edwardian conservatories, named after the reign of King Edward VII (1901-1910), are identified by their roomy design, in proportion shape, and using premium materials. These conservatories generally feature:
- A flat front with a pitched roofing system
- High windows that maximize natural light
- A wider flooring space than Victorian conservatories, enabling a more versatile living area
Design Features of Edwardian Conservatories
|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Roof Style | Pitched, enabling excellent drain and headroom |
| Shape | Square or rectangle-shaped, creating a roomy environment |
| Windows | High and frequently in a 1:3 percentage, making the most of light and reducing glare |
| Materials | Standard timber, modern uPVC, or aluminum, often double-glazed for insulation |
| Flooring Options | Various choices, consisting of tile, wood, or stone, depending on the interior decoration |

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: How much does an Edwardian conservatory expense?
A1: Costs can vary extensively depending upon size, materials, and design intricacy. Typically, house owners can anticipate to pay in between ₤ 10,000 to ₤ 30,000.
Q2: How long does it require to build an Edwardian conservatory?
A2: The construction procedure generally takes in between 4 to 8 weeks, depending on weather conditions and particular job requirements.
Q3: Do I require preparing approval for an Edwardian conservatory?
A3: In lots of cases, Edwardian conservatories fall under allowed development rules. However, local regulations can vary, so it is suggested to contact your local council.
